lln my former construction there was no water discharge connection directly opposite the tubing connection. These anchor fittings are particularly useful in high-pres sure wells. li a lateral discharge is used the lateral thrust when the or water is dis charged to the atmosphere may be suthcient to bend the pipe and injure the connection. By making the water discharge opening directly opposite the tubing connection this ditlioulty is obviated and at the same time a convenient connection is made laterally to the line. ln'operation, when it is desired to blow out the well, the valve l3is closed and the valve 10 opened and when it is desired to close the discharge and openthe line the valve 10 is closed and the valveld opened.
